CDN对Core Web Vitals的影响:优化网站速度与用户体验的核心方法
做CDN這一行十幾年了,我親眼見證太多網站因為速度慢而流失用戶。Core Web Vitals(CWV)這指標,現在成了Google排名的大殺器,說白了就是用戶體驗的體溫計。LCP、FID、CLS這三項,哪一項掉鏈子,訪客可能立馬點擊關閉。CDN呢?它不只是加速工具,更像個隱形工程師,從底層重構速度。
記得去年幫一家電商平台優化,他們LCP平均要5秒,用戶跳出率高得嚇人。我們導入CDN後,把靜態資源快取到邊緣節點,比如圖片、CSS檔,瞬間LCP壓到2秒內。關鍵在於地理分布——用戶在台北請求,CDN從本地節點回應,不用繞半個地球回源伺服器。延遲降了,加載自然快。這不是理論,是實戰經驗。用Cloudflare或Akamai這類服務商,他們全球節點密如蛛網,亞洲用戶訪問歐美網站,速度也能飆起來。
FID優化更微妙。用戶點擊按鈕卻卡住?常是主機回應慢惹的禍。CDN分擔流量,減少源伺服器壓力。我們配置時會用HTTP/3協議,基於QUIC減少握手時間,FID從300毫秒砍到100毫秒以下。有一次客戶遭DDoS攻擊,流量暴增十倍,但CDN的緩存層擋住大部分請求,源站沒崩潰,FID照樣穩定。這點Fastly做得特別好,他們的即時緩存更新機制,確保動態內容也能快速響應。
CLS問題最惱人,圖片加載時版面亂跳,用戶體驗爛透。CDN通過預加載和資源壓縮來解決。比如設定快取規則,讓字型檔優先加載,避免渲染延遲。我們測試過,用Brotli壓縮比Gzip省20%帶寬,CLS分數直接升一級。實務上,選CDN服務商要挑支援TLS 1.3的,像Google Cloud CDN,加密握手更快,版面更穩。
深度來說,CDN不是萬靈丹。配置錯了反拖累性能。我有次失誤,快取過期時間設太長,用戶看到舊內容,CLS反而惡化。得根據業務調整——電商促銷頁快取短些,新聞站長些。全球服務商中,Akamai在安全整合上強,但貴;Cloudflare性價比高,適合中小企業;AWS CloudFront彈性大,但學習曲線陡。關鍵是監控工具,用WebPageTest或Lighthouse定期測CWV,數據不會騙人。
歸根結柢,CDN是優化CWV的核心引擎。它把速度、安全、體驗綁一起,用戶滿意了,轉化率自然上升。這行幹久了,我悟出一點:技術再炫,終究服務於人。一個快半秒的網站,可能就多留住一位顧客。
评论: